Healthgrades.com is the leading online marketplace to find and connect with the right doctor, the right hospital, and the right care. The Sr. Product Analyst will partner with product and engineering teams to use data and analytics to define, implement, and measure product features in order to understand our customer experiences on Healthgrades.com. We’re looking for a data-driven individual who has extensive experience telling a story with data and a passion for solving customer problems to join our BI teams and use analytics to drive product feature development and strategy.

What You'll Do:

  • Partner with Product Development, Design, Engineering, Data, and Marketing to use data to drive product decisions
  • Collaborate with stakeholders and the BI team to develop business unit metrics and/or key performance indicators
  • Drive communication and data storytelling best practices and thought leadership across product and BI
  • Build reporting solutions that leverage Tableau to answer key business questions
  • Define technical implementations to ensure accurate, scalable web tracking
  • Document and communicate findings and insights to business unit leaders, and provide strategic recommendations with clear business outcomes and assumptions
  • Answer ad-hoc analytics questions to support business operations

What We're Looking For: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business, Analytics, or equivalent experience
  • 3+ years experience working in analytics, preferably product experience
  • Proficient in SQL and BI visualization tools, Tableau preferred
  • Experience in web analytics / clickstream data preferred
  • Strong communication skills, both with technical and non-technical audiences
  • Expert ability to tell stories with data, educate and motivate stakeholders to act on recommendations
  • Inquisitive and consultative mindset, rather than reacting to circumstances
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and end-to-end quantitative thinking
  • Ability to assess and address data quality concerns
  • Ability to translate data findings into actionable recommendations and process improvements
  • Ability to set priorities and manage time to complete tasks and meet deadlines

Who We Are: 

Over the last twenty years, Red Ventures has built a portfolio of influential brands, digital platforms, and strategic partnerships that work together to connect millions of people with expert advice. Through premium content and personalized digital experiences, Red Ventures builds online journeys that make it easier for people to make important decisions about their homes, health, travel, finances, education and entertainment. Founded in 2000, Red Ventures has 3,000 employees in 10 cities across the US, as well as in the UK and Brazil. Red Ventures owns and operates several large digital brands including Healthline, The Points Guy, Bankrate, MYMOVE, and Allconnect.com.
